    Title:Design of optical system for SG-III near backscatter diagnosis
    Author(s):Yan, Ya-Dong(1); He, Jun-Hua(1); Wang, Feng(2); Zhang, Min(1); Li, Shi-Bo(1,3)
    Source: Guangxue Jingmi Gongcheng/Optics and Precision Engineering  Volume: 22  Issue: 6  DOI: 10.3788/OPE.20142206.1469  Published: June 2014  
    Abstract:After analysis the collecting methods of near backscatter light in laser fusion, a metal ellipsoidal mirror was proposed to collect the near backscatter light of SG-III laser facility. Then, the method to determine the parameters of ellipsoidal mirror was discussed. The mirror is composed of four pieces, which makes it entering into the target chamber easily. The mirror is made of super hard aluminum, and a triangular weight reducing slot is designed on the back of the mirror to reduce its weight and improve its mechanical stability. The overall structure of the optical system was introduced, and the light gathering performance was simulated using optical software. The key issues in ellipsoidal mirror design, including material selection and structure selection, were analyzed. In order to avoid rework, a semiconductor laser array was developed specially to test the surface in design processing. The stray lights in the system were analyzed, physical isolation, optical absorbing and optical filters were used to control them. The ring ellipsoidal mirror with a weight of 48 kg has an outside diameter of 1200 mm, an inside diameter of 400 mm, the maximum off-axis magnitude of 1411 mm, and the maximum thickness of 67 mm. The image spot size is about 1.2 mm within a field of view 5 mm. This system mentioned above can offer a reference for near backscatter diagnostic in inertial confinement fusion research.

    Title:Road vehicle information collection system based on distributed fiber optics sensor
    Author(s):Feng, Li Li(1); Wang, Yun Tao(1); Ruan, Chi(1); Tao, Sheng(2)
    Source: Advanced Materials Research  Volume: 1030-1032  Issue:   DOI: 10.4028/www.scientific.net/AMR.1030-1032.2105  Published: 2014  
    Abstract:A novel distributed fiber optics sensor used for road vehicle information collection system was proposed. Optical fiber was fixed on the road surface to be used as the sensing media. The vehicle information such as speed, vehicle type, vehicle weight and traffic flow can be obtained. To increase the sensitivity of such sensor, an optical Fabry-Perot (F-P) fiber interference was used. Sensing optical fiber was designed to be with a metal coating for fiber protection and high performance. Experiment results show that such distributed fiber optics sensor may be with a high performance in transportation area without digging when it is installed on the road surface. ?     Title:Integrated frequency comb source of heralded single photons
    Author(s):Reimer, Christian(1); Caspani, Lucia(1); Clerici, Matteo(1,2); Ferrera, Marcello(1,2); Kues, Michael(1); Peccianti, Marco(1,3); Pasquazi, Alessia(1,3); Razzari, Luca(1); Little, Brent E.(4); Chu, Sai T.(5); Moss, David J.(1,6); Morandotti, Roberto(1)
    Source: Optics Express  Volume: 22  Issue: 6  DOI: 10.1364/OE.22.006535  Published: 41722  
    Abstract:We report an integrated photon pair source based on a CMOScompatible microring resonator that generates multiple, simultaneous, and independent photon pairs at different wavelengths in a frequency comb compatible with fiber communication wavelength division multiplexing channels (200 GHz channel separation) and with a linewidth that is compatible with quantum memories (110 MHz). It operates in a self-locked pump configuration, avoiding the need for active stabilization, making it extremely robust even at very low power levels. ? 2014 Optical Society of America.

    Title:Simulation study on slant-to-vertical deviation in two dimensional TEC mapping over the ionosphere equatorial anomaly
    Author(s):Yu, Tao(1,2); Mao, Tian(2); Wang, Yungang(2); Zeng, Zhongcao(2); Xia, Chunliang(1); Wu, Fenglei(3); Wang, Le(4)
    Source: Advances in Space Research  Volume: 54  Issue: 4  DOI: 10.1016/j.asr.2014.04.015  Published: August 15, 2014  
    Abstract:With the rapid increase of GPS/GNSS receivers being deployed and operated in China, real-time GPS data from nearly a thousand sites are available at the National Center for Space Weather, China Meteorology Administration. However, it is challenging to generate a high-quality regional total electron content (TEC) map with the traditional two-dimensional (2-D) retrieval scheme because a large horizontal gradient has been reported over east-south Asia due to the northern equatorial ionization anomaly. We developed an Ionosphere Data Assimilation Analysis System (IDAAS), which is described in this study, using an International Reference Ionosphere (IRI) model as the background and applying a Kalman filter for updated observations. The IDAAS can reconstruct a three-dimensional ionosphere with the GPS slant TEC. The inverse slant TEC correlates well with observations both for GPS sites involved in the reconstruction and sites that are not involved. Based on the IDAAS, simulations were performed to investigate the deviation relative to the slant-to-vertical conversion (STV). The results indicate that the relative deviation induced by slant-to-vertical conversion may be significant in certain instances, and the deviation varies from 0% to 40% when the elevation decreases from 90° to 15°, while the relative IDAAS deviation is much smaller and varies from -5% to 15% without an elevation dependence. Compared with 'true TEC' map derived from the model, there is large difference in STV TEC map but no obvious discrepancy in IDAAS map. Generally, the IDAAS TEC map is much closer to the "true TEC" than is STV TEC map is. It is suggested that three-dimensional inversion technique is necessary for GPS observations of low elevation at an equatorial anomaly region, wherein the high horizontal electron density gradient may produce significant slant-to-vertical deviations using the two-dimensional STV inversion method. ? 2014 COSPAR.
